Firefighters Battle Early Morning Fire at Business Park in Lawrenceburg

Multiple businesses suffered damage, according to Lawrenceburg Fire.

Photo provided.

(Lawrenceburg, Ind.) - Multiple agencies responded to a fire at the business park off of Industrial Drive in Lawrenceburg early Friday morning. 

Lawrenceburg Fire Chief Johnnie Tremain tells Eagle Country 99.3 that Lawrenceburg Police discovered the fire around 1:31 a.m. Firefighters from Lawrenceburg, Greendale, Aurora, Whitewater Township, and Miamitown responded to the scene at Charles A. Liddle Drive. 

Multiple businesses were impacted by the fire. The business types included excavating, construction, vending and motorcycle repair.  

Tremain estimates damage could be in the hundreds-of-thousands or potentially over a million dollars. 

No injuries were reported, but responders were unable to locate two dogs. 

A cause of the fire remains under investigation.
